Output 087b8088d1340f8a16712e00c42b13cbc2c3bce87607069d1c0f890478aac9fe:2

value
134095742
script pubkey
OP_0 OP_PUSHBYTES_20 50966b3b7045c177ca3e41e7fd6f68ca19c93bd9
address
tb1q2ztxkwmsghqh0j37g8nl6mmgegvujw7enayfds
transaction
087b8088d1340f8a16712e00c42b13cbc2c3bce87607069d1c0f890478aac9fe
confirmations
42953
spent
true